Hi, We are moving our RADIUS services from an old RedHat box to a SuSE 8.2 box, but we are experiencing problems. We use the Livingston RADIUS package from the SuSE 8.2 CD's (radiusd-livingston-2.1-348). As soon as it authenticated a client, it exits on signal 100. I have not found any solutions with Google, only that this error was supposed to be fixed in version 2.0 Any ideas how to fix this?
